Low coolant light: Sensed on tank of radiator usually. This may not have a cap on the radiator to check fluid level actually in the radiator but a recovery tank that may be showing proper level and with certain problems it doesn't indicated the real level in the radiator/cooling system itself. If it's that type you might (engine cold and off) just squeeze the upper radiator hose and see bubbles at the recovery tank as a clue that rad is in fact getting low - the reason why is more important than just being low,
